What is a breeding farm?

A breeding farm is a specialized agricultural facility dedicated to the controlled reproduction of animals, such as horses, cattle, dogs, or other livestock. These farms focus on producing animals with desirable traits, often for commercial, sporting, or conservation purposes. Breeding farms typically manage all aspects of animal care, genetic selection, mating, and sometimes the early raising of offspring. Staff may include breeders, veterinarians, and caretakers who ensure the health and well-being of the animals throughout the breeding process.

What are some common challenges encountered when working on a breeding farm, and how can I prepare for them?

Working on a breeding farm often involves long hours, seasonal workloads, and physically demanding tasks such as handling animals, monitoring breeding cycles, and assisting with births. Weather conditions can also pose challenges, as most work is outdoors or in barns regardless of climate. To prepare, it's important to build physical stamina, become familiar with animal handling safety, and develop good time management skills. Many farms offer mentorship and on-the-job training, so a willingness to learn and adapt will be invaluable.

While both roles are involved in animal breeding, a Breeding Farm is a facility or operation that manages and oversees breeding programs, often employing multiple technicians. A Breeding Technician focuses on the hands-on work of breeding animals and monitoring their health within the farm. The farm provides the environment and management, whereas the technician executes daily breeding activities.

What occupations are available on a breeding farm?

Occupations on a breeding farm include roles such as farm workers, animal caretakers, breeding technicians, and farm managers. These positions often require knowledge of animal husbandry, breeding techniques, and sometimes certifications in animal care or veterinary assistance. Workers typically perform tasks related to feeding, cleaning, monitoring animal health, and maintaining breeding records.
